Basically what the topic says: Looping the audio is not a seamless loop, there's a small buffer when the loop restarts.
I've thrown everything I could think of at it: Re-encoding the audio file several times to match sample rates and try different filetypes, put it in a playlist, cutting beginning/end, marking in/out points in the timeline
and probably a lot more that I can't currently think of in my exhausted state of mind.
There's one thing I have in mind that I haven't tried, and that is to change audio output on vMix (In case there's *something* on my machine that would interfere).

I don't know if anyone else has come across this issue, but any assistance would be helpful if there's something that I've missed... or if this has turned into a vMix thing all of a sudden.

For reference, I worked on a broadcast last year where the loop function worked *perfect*, this issue that I have now wasn't an issue before.
